Output 34033fbfa3b460bb31fdfe8e24aa39c7b0e70620c3f77ae5b556a8e9f51a87d5:0

value
16296754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b4f8707637f53e5b6e7353ea78ffdbdbc7fdaa8 OP_EQUAL
address
34BRSPSZBoa9rYjC2DHT9Bzr6Q75PwRDNU
transaction
34033fbfa3b460bb31fdfe8e24aa39c7b0e70620c3f77ae5b556a8e9f51a87d5
confirmations
183862
spent
true